summ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orDaniel Kahn Gillmor <dkg@fifthhorseman.net>2009-07-14 01:31:31 -0400
committerDaniel Kahn Gillmor <dkg@fifthhorseman.net>2009-07-14 01:31:31 -0400
commitfcdbba726ead3e13856c05881ea768bb74a078ff (patch)
tree0fc54462c4c2db436983f88b0f959e730d337294 /src
parent8c9c2f20a9897605724cdf8ca89c21391bd621ed (diff)
monkeysphere-host add-hostname now uses perl backend.
Diffstat (limited to 'src')
-rw-r--r--src/share/mh/add_hostname12
1 files changed, 3 insertions, 9 deletions
diff --git a/src/share/mh/add_hostname b/src/share/mh/add_hostname
index 9465d96..9df5eec 100644
--- a/src/share/mh/add_hostname
+++ b/src/share/mh/add_hostname
@@ -41,16 +41,10 @@ else
log debug "adding user ID without prompting."
fi
-# edit-key script command to add user ID
-adduidCommand="adduid
-$userID
-
-
-save"
-# end script
-
# execute edit-key script
-if echo "$adduidCommand" | gpg_host_edit ; then
+if <"$GNUPGHOME_HOST/secring.gpg" "$SYSSHAREDIR/keytrans" adduserid \
+ "$HOST_FINGERPRINT" "$userID" | gpg_host --import ; then
+ gpg_host --check-trustdb
update_gpg_pub_file